The ampere is a unit of which physical quantity?

Electrical current is measured using the ampere.

For this case we have by definition, that the Ampere, is the unit of electric current intensity.

For its part, the electric current is a measure of the velocity at which the electric charge flows.

The symbol of the current is A. We have that 1 Ampere is equivalent to an electric charge of a coulomb per second.

[tex]1A = \frac {1C} {s}[/tex]
